    When we released our 5 Legendary Snare Sounds video ( • 5 Legendary Snare Soun... ) we would have never guessed that this one would once have more than 1.5 million views. Thank you all for that!
    Since many of you requested a second part: Here it is.
    We listened to your requests and came up with a 5 very recognizable snare sounds from Prince to Limp Bizkit. All those very different snare sounds have their own characteristics and will work great in many different musical scenarios. Have fun experimenting with those ideas yourself!

    I read that Alex Van Halen used a 6.5 X 14 Tama Rosewood on Hot For Teacher, but you guys came as close to his sound as I've ever heard. Nice work!

    • @steevidrums
      @steevidrums Před 7 měsíci

      Have you seen Rick Beato video on recreating that snare sound? He got it damn close too, more so in my opinion. It's definitely worth a look.

    • @8hfcvfwr
      @8hfcvfwr Před 4 měsíci

      Yep TAMA Rosewood Mastercraft was the drum.
      The head and gaffer tape are correct as well as the sound.
      Rick Beato does a good job as recreating that legendary sound. Also, Brian Tichy uses the real deal rosewood and nails the sound.
